Method

  1. Stir the vinegar into the milk and leave for 5 minutes to make 'buttermilk'.
  2. Whisk the flour, sugar, baking powder and salt in a large bowl. Pour in the milk, oil and vanilla and stir just until combined — a few lumps are fine. Do not over-mix, or they'll be tough. Rest 5 minutes.
  3. Heat a non-stick frying pan over medium heat and brush with a little oil. Drop in 3 tbsp of batter per pancake and cook for 2–3 minutes until bubbles form on top and the edges look set.
  4. Flip and cook 1–2 minutes more until golden. Keep warm in a low oven while you cook the rest.
  5. Stack high and serve with maple syrup and fruit.

💡 VeggieTip notes

  • The batter should be thick but pourable. Too thick? Add a splash of milk.
  • Add blueberries or chocolate chips to each pancake right after pouring.
  • Freeze cooked pancakes between baking paper and toast from frozen.
